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- male and female volunteers
- experienced in athletic training (> 5 years of experience)
- aged 20 to 30 years
- free from musculoskeletal dysfunctions
- free from metabolic and heart diseases
Exclusion Criteria:
- pregnancy
- use of hormonal contraceptives
- use of dietary supplement that contains any ergogenic agent
